Gear pump shaft tail mechanical sealing device
By integrating sealing components and using a split wear-resistant ring design, the problems of complex structure and low reliability of traditional gear pump shaft tail mechanical seals are solved, achieving simplified assembly, reduced costs, and improved sealing performance.

Technical Field
[0001] This invention relates to the field of dynamic seal design technology. Background Technology
[0002] A gear pump shaft tail mechanical seal is a shaft sealing device used on the rotating shaft of a gear pump. It prevents fluid leakage through the relative movement of two precisely matched sealing surfaces. It has advantages such as good sealing effect, long service life, and adaptability to harsh working conditions. If the gear pump shaft tail mechanical seal fails, it will lead to fluid leakage, which may result in fluid loss or even serious safety accidents.
[0003] Currently, traditional gear pump shaft tails have complex mechanical structures, are difficult to assemble, and have high production costs. Summary of the Invention
[0004] The purpose of this invention is to provide a mechanical seal device for the tail shaft of a gear pump, which can effectively reduce the number of parts in the mechanical seal structure, improve the assemblability of the mechanical seal, avoid seal failure caused by misalignment of parts, improve the reliability of the mechanical seal, and reduce production and maintenance costs.
[0005] To solve the above-mentioned technical problems, the present invention provides a mechanical seal device for the tail shaft of a gear pump, comprising a drive shaft and a housing mounted on the drive shaft. A sealing assembly is provided between the drive shaft and the housing. The sealing assembly includes an integrated sealing assembly and a guide ring. The guide ring is assembled on the drive shaft and rotates synchronously with the drive shaft. The integrated sealing assembly is fixed to the housing. The end face of the guide ring is provided with a sealing groove, and a shaft sealing ring is installed in the sealing groove to achieve axial sealing between the guide ring and the drive shaft. The end face of the guide ring is also provided with a guide hole penetrating its body. One end of the guide hole communicates with the sealing groove, and the other end opens to the outside. The integrated sealing assembly includes a sealing shell connected to the housing. The sealing shell is a cylindrical structure with one open end, and its open end has a constricted portion formed by inward rolling. The inner wall of the sealing shell has a guide groove extending axially. A wear-resistant ring is provided inside the sealing shell. The outer circumference of the wear-resistant ring cooperates with the guide groove to restrict its circumferential rotation. The end face of the wear-resistant ring is in contact with the end face of the guide ring and slides relative to it. A compensating spring is provided between the wear-resistant ring and the sealing shell. The compensating spring acts on the wear-resistant ring to keep the end face of the wear-resistant ring pressed against the end face of the guide ring. An inner sealing ring is provided between the compensating spring and the constricted portion for sealing between the sealing shell and the wear-resistant ring. An outer sealing ring is provided between the sealing shell and the housing for sealing between the integrated sealing assembly and the housing.
[0006] The wear-resistant ring has a split structure, including a wear-resistant ring base and a wear-resistant ring ring. The wear-resistant ring base is made of high-strength metal material, and its outer periphery is provided with a sliding part that works in conjunction with the guide groove, and its interior is provided with an installation groove. The wear-resistant ring is made of wear-resistant material and has a regular rotating body structure, which is fixedly installed in the installation groove.
[0007] The end face of the wear-resistant ring is in contact with the end face of the guide ring and slides relative to each other.
[0008] The wear-resistant ring is fixedly connected to the wear-resistant ring base by an adhesive.
[0009] The housing has a locking groove at the installation position of the integrated sealing component, and an elastic locking ring is provided in the locking groove to axially limit the integrated sealing component on the housing.
[0010] The flow guide holes are multiple through holes distributed circumferentially along the flow guide ring.
[0011] The compensation spring is a wave spring or a helical spring.
[0012] Both the inner and outer sealing rings are O-rings.
[0013] The guide groove is at least two protrusions or grooves extending axially along the inner wall of the sealing shell.

[0029] Example 2 The guide ring 10 is mounted on the drive shaft 1. The guide ring 10 is provided with a sealing groove and a guide hole 12. The shaft seal ring 11 is installed in the sealing groove between the guide ring 12 and the drive shaft 1. The guide hole 12 communicates with the outside of the guide ring 10. When the product is working, the oil entering the sealing groove of the guide ring 10 will be thrown to the outside of the guide ring 10 through the guide hole 12 under the action of centrifugal force. This ensures the seal while improving the fluidity of the oil inside the product, thereby avoiding local high temperature phenomenon and improving the sealing performance of the entire mechanism.
[0030] The integrated sealing assembly consists of a sealing shell 2, a compensating spring 4, a wear-resistant ring 8, and an inner sealing ring 5. A guide groove 7 is provided in the sealing shell 2 to restrict the circumferential movement of the wear-resistant ring 8. A tapering part 9 is provided at the tail end of the sealing shell 2 to prevent the wear-resistant ring 8, the compensating spring 4, and the inner sealing ring 5 from falling off. The wear-resistant ring 8 and the guide ring 10 of the integrated sealing assembly are tightly fitted under the action of the compensating spring 4, preventing oil leakage from the mating surface. An outer sealing ring 6 is provided between the integrated sealing assembly and the housing 13 to prevent oil leakage from the gap between the housing 13 and the integrated sealing assembly. A locking groove is provided on the housing 13. After the integrated seal is assembled, an elastic locking ring 3 is installed. For disassembly, the elastic locking ring 3 is removed to remove the drive shaft 1, the guide ring 10, and the integrated sealing assembly. This simplifies the product structure, facilitates installation and disassembly, improves the reliability of the gear pump shaft tail mechanical seal, reduces product maintenance costs, and shortens maintenance cycles.
[0031] Example 3 In the prior art, the wear-resistant ring 8 is made of powder metallurgy wear-resistant material. Because this material is relatively "brittle", the structure of the wear-resistant ring 8 is as shown in 7. It has a sliding groove 14 and a sealing groove 15 inside. The geometry is complex and the structural strength is insufficient. It is very difficult to process and is easily damaged during transportation and assembly.
[0032] To address this problem, this embodiment provides a novel structure, such as... Figures 4-6 As shown, the wear-resistant ring 8 is divided into a wear-resistant ring rigid base 16 and a wear-resistant ring 17. The wear-resistant ring 17 is a regular rotating body, as shown in the figure. Figure 5 As shown, the material is consistent with that of the wear-resistant ring 8; the complex parts are processed separately, and the structure of the wear-resistant ring rigid matrix 16 is as follows. Figure 6 As shown, this part is machined from high-strength steel, which reduces the difficulty of machining while increasing the product strength. Finally, the two parts are glued together. This structure satisfies dynamic sealing while also increasing product strength. In the design, the thickness of the wear ring 17 can be relatively thinner, and the contact area between the thin wear ring 17 and the guide ring 10 is smaller, thereby reducing the heat generation at the shaft tail.
